Type 1 Diabetes is a chronic condition in which the pancreas produces little to no insulin. This means that individuals with Type 1 Diabetes must carefully manage their blood sugar levels through insulin injections and monitoring their diet and exercise. Regular medical check-ups are crucial for managing this condition, as healthcare professionals can help individuals optimize their treatment plan and identify any potential complications early on.
